Drywall Service in Overland Park, KS
Drywall services encompass the installation, repair, and finishing of drywall panels used to create interior walls and ceilings in residential properties. These services are commonly requested for new construction projects, remodeling, or to address damage such as holes, cracks, or water stains. Homeowners often seek professional drywall work to achieve smooth, even surfaces that are ready for painting or other wall treatments, ensuring a polished appearance throughout living spaces.
Before requesting drywall services, property owners should consider the scope of their project, including whether it involves new installations, patching existing walls, or repairing damage. It’s helpful to understand the types of drywall finishes available, such as smooth or textured surfaces, and to communicate any specific aesthetic preferences or structural concerns. Clarifying these details can help ensure the finished result aligns with the overall design and functionality of the home.

Common Drywall Service Jobs
Drywall Installation - installing new drywall for walls and ceilings in residential spaces.
Drywall Repair - fixing holes, cracks, and water damage to restore wall surfaces.
Texturing Services - adding textures to drywall for aesthetic or matching existing finishes.
Finishing and Taping - smoothing joints and seams for a seamless wall appearance.
Water Damage Restoration - repairing drywall affected by leaks or flooding to prevent mold growth.
Soundproofing Solutions - installing drywall with soundproofing features for improved privacy.
Drywall Service Questions
What types of drywall services are available? Services include installation, repair, finishing, and texture matching for both residential and commercial properties.
Can drywall be repaired after damage? Yes, common repairs include fixing holes, cracks, and water damage to restore a smooth surface.
What should property owners know about drywall finishing? Proper finishing involves taping, mudding, and sanding to achieve a seamless surface ready for painting or wallpaper.
Are there options for matching existing drywall textures? Texture matching is available to blend repairs seamlessly with existing wall or ceiling finishes.
